How to Marry a Ghost

Ghostwriter Lee Bartholomew heads to New York to be the maid of honor in her mother's wedding/ commitment ceremony (even though she's still married to Lee's father) and to interview for the job of ghostwriting an autobiography by aging rock legend Shotgun Marriott. But her time in the States doesn't go quite as she planned. First she learns she lost the ghostwriting job to a much younger, ambitious hustler named Bettina. Then the body of a man in a wedding dress washes up right after Lee's mom is married in a beautiful oceanside ceremony-and he turns out to be none other than Shotgun Marriott's estranged son! When Bettina is also murdered, Lee finds herself stepping into the dead woman's ghosting shoes-before the killer strikes again.
